What is that Darkest? Obviously it has some strange electrical power, but it looks totally bizarre. According to the PlayStation Blog, no one is really sure what it is.

Darkbeast
A malformed beast enveloped in blue lightning.
With a long body made of only bones, and a wrinkle-covered skull, people say this beast must be very old, very ancient.
Or perhaps, it is a descendent of the city of the plague of beasts.
